### Receipt mailer stuck?

If Heartpost receipts stop going out, check the Dovetail queue depth first — anything over 500 means the renderer wedged. Restart the renderer pod, then replay failed jobs with the replay script. The replay script talks to the internal mailer API, so it needs the on-call key, included below.

gateway credential: kto3_qfe

## Who to ping about GiftNote

Welcome aboard! GiftNote is our donation-receipt mailer for the Larchfield Fund. Template tweaks go to the comms folks; delivery failures and bounce weirdness go to the platform crew. Don't push template changes on Fridays — receipts batch over the weekend. For anything GiftNote-related, start with the address below.

billing contact of kaweg-tajeg = drudor.lamion.oliath@torvalabs.test

## Authentication

Quick note for whoever inherits Fontcellar next: the vendored typefaces (Grovania Sans and Mistletype Mono) are pulled from the Thornbury asset vault during the build, not committed to the repo. Licensing rules, don't ask. The fetch script needs credentials or it silently falls back to system fonts, which looks terrible. Rotate the credential quarterly per the vault policy. The script reads its auth from the line below.

session JWT of yawep-yawep = eyJhbGciOiJIUzI1NiIsInR5cCI6IkpXVCJ9.eyJzdWIiOiI3pWF3_In0.aXYsHiog